New to snuff-taking (about 3 months) and I’ve experimented with a few ways of insufflating - none of which have given me an ‘AHA!’ moment.
My current snuffs include Honey Bee, ASC Peach, ASC Scotch Dental, and Tube Rose.
The Honey Bee (super fine) and Peach (fine) are the most enjoyable; however, the former often causes coughing fits while the latter smells nice, but the sweetness is never tasted.
I say all of that to ask: What should I be feeling after snuffing? More specifically, where should the snuff be sitting once sniffed/inhaled? For me, it either sits in my front nostril (causes tingling and pleasant smell, but no taste), the back of my nose (causing a throat itch but I can taste it), or on my sinuses (causing sneezing but I can taste it).
Methods Tried:
- Front of nose/Scrunched Nose (Pro: Easy to take, pleasant smell; Con: No sweetness)
- Pinched Nostril (Pro: Easy to take, Con: Clogs Nose)
- Boxcar (Pro: Feels best, Con: Causes Sneezing and Coughing)
- Snuff Bullet (Pro: Feels right; Con: Hits the sinuses or doesn’t hit at all)
- Knuckles (Pro: Good for some snuffs, Con: Messy)
- Back of Hand (Pro: Goes right in for all snuffs; Con: Messy, Inconsistent delivery)
Is there a “zone” or “spot” I should be aiming for to maximize both smell and taste? Or do I just snuff for whichever I find more satisfying?
